BenQ Color Shuttle: How to Easily Customize Gaming Monitor Settings for Every Game

I think many of you reading this article are using gaming monitors. When you get a gaming monitor, many of you probably adjust the brightness and color to your liking.

So, how many of you change the brightness and color tone for each game?

Some monitors can store multiple user settings, but it’s rare for people to change monitor settings for each of the many games they play. Even though there is a need to make dark areas more noticeable in games to make it easier to spot enemies, or to increase the color saturation to immerse yourself in flashy images, it is difficult to spend all that time on them.

BenQ’s gaming monitor “MOBIUZ” series and dedicated software “Color Shuttle” released in September 2023 make this easy. This software not only allows you to save your monitor’s video settings and easily switch between them, but also allows you to exchange settings files with other users over the Internet.

You want to download carefully selected settings for each game, you want to recommend the settings that you have thoroughly pursued to others, you want to use the settings that professional gamers use…these can be easily achieved, and the possibilities for the video of the game are increased. Because “Color Shuttle” saves monitor settings, it must be used in conjunction with a compatible “MOBIUZ” gaming monitor. There is a list of compatible monitors on the official Color Shuttle website, and as of February there are 5 models. In addition to new models, some existing products will be supported through updates.

List of compatible models for “Color Shuttle” (as of February)

  • EX2710Q:27 inches/2,560×1,440/165Hz/IPS
  • EX3410R:34 inches/3,440×1,440/144Hz/VA
  • EX3210U:32 inches/3,840×2,160/144Hz/IPS
  • EX270QM:27 inches/2,560×1,440/240Hz/IPS
  • EX2710U:27 inch/3,840×2,160/144Hz/IPS
  • EX480UZ: 48 inches/3,840×2,160/120Hz/IPS (Compatibility date to be determined)

The setup order is to connect a compatible monitor to your PC and then run “Color Shuttle”. Please note that “Color Shuttle” will not start unless a compatible monitor is connected.

When you start “Color Shuttle”, a window will appear with the name of the model you are using. Each game image in the window is a video settings file.

To use it, select the configuration file you want to use and click the downward arrow mark. Next, a window called “Apply Color” will appear, so select Gamer 1, Gamer 2, or Gamer 3. This is a frame for user settings saved on the monitor side, and this means that there are three frames available for this unit.

Click the arrow mark displayed on the title icon, select one of the three custom settings frames, and save.

When you select it, the screen turns black, and after a while, the screen display changes to match the settings file. A window asking whether to apply will be displayed, so if there is no problem, click Apply. Click Cancel if you want to revert. This is all there is to apply from the configuration file.

There were only three pre-prepared configuration files, but you can also download configuration files for other games. The official Color Shuttle website provides configuration files for various games that can be downloaded.

Clicking on the down arrow in the cloud at the bottom of the Color Shuttle window launches a web browser and displays the download site. In addition to listing the configuration files for notable titles, there is also a search box further down that allows you to search by game title.

Configuration files for notable titles are also distributed on the official website.

For example, if you search for “Cyberpunk 2077”, you will find the settings file for “Cyberpunk 2077″ (Japanese is not supported, so search with the English title name). An official file named “BenQ Color Expert” is available for this work.

You can search for the settings file for the game you want to play.

The configuration file is a file with the extension “.mbz”. Click the folder mark at the bottom right of the “Color Shuttle” window to open the folder where the settings file will be placed, so move the downloaded file here. The downloaded settings file will then be reflected in the “Color Shuttle” window. After that, just apply it to the monitor as explained above.

There are two types of configuration files, one for SDR and one for HDR, and when HDR is turned on in Windows settings, you can use the configuration file for HDR. When HDR is off, it can only be used for SDR. Unusable files are displayed darkly and cannot be selected. Since the color information displayed in HDR and SDR is different, “Color Shuttle” controls it so that there is no confusion.

You can find configuration files not only for PC games, but also for console titles such as PlayStation 5 and Nintendo Switch. Although it is not available for all games, you can find it for most major titles, so please look for it. You can search and download files even if you don’t have a compatible monitor.

Easily share your own video settings on SNS

Next is how to share your monitor settings with others. At the bottom right of the Color Shuttle window, click the icon with the arrow pointing upwards to the right. When using the app for the first time, you will be asked to sign in with your Google account from the Color Shuttle app.

The next window that appears will have two input boxes. Above, write the file name of the configuration file to be published. The bottom says “Game Tag,” but if you enter the game title, an icon that matches it will be displayed below. After selecting the appropriate game icon, click “Export” below.

The configuration file will then be saved in the cloud and a download URL will be displayed.

A download URL will be issued

You can also post to Facebook, X, and Reddit. If you try selecting X, a posting screen similar to the image below will be displayed.
